diff options
author | aszlig <aszlig@redmoonstudios.org> | 2017-09-06 23:30:09 +0200 |
---|---|---|
committer | aszlig <aszlig@redmoonstudios.org> | 2017-09-06 23:30:09 +0200 |
commit | 78d0bb96051de8bd86432b4fadcdf5eea6a40a0b (patch) | |
tree | d4103dd8f1c250eed6dd871283416b27430f07d6 /tests/system/kernel/bfq.nix | |
parent | d3188f2051563bb077a0d54b9750be7e8307417b (diff) |
tests/bfq: Use SCSI disk interface
Using the virtio disk interface isn't very suitable for real-world simulation, so let's use the SCSI interface, because SATA is exposed to userland as a SCSI device. Signed-off-by: aszlig <aszlig@redmoonstudios.org> Cc: @devhell
Diffstat (limited to 'tests/system/kernel/bfq.nix')
-rw-r--r-- | tests/system/kernel/bfq.nix |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/tests/system/kernel/bfq.nix b/tests/system/kernel/bfq.nix index 38c354a9..7b6314b1 100644 --- a/tests/system/kernel/bfq.nix +++ b/tests/system/kernel/bfq.nix @@ -4,10 +4,11 @@ machine = { pkgs, ... }: { vuizvui.system.kernel.bfq.enable = true; vuizvui.system.kernel.useBleedingEdge = true; + virtualisation.qemu.diskInterface = "scsi"; }; testScript = '' $machine->execute('tail /sys/block/*/queue/scheduler >&2'); - $machine->succeed('grep -HF "[bfq]" /sys/block/vda/queue/scheduler'); + $machine->succeed('grep -HF "[bfq]" /sys/block/sda/queue/scheduler'); ''; } |